wellness • Tuition assistance POSITION OVERVIEW: The Product Development Processing Scientist is responsible for the scale up process during commercialization and is the liaison between bench top development and manufacturing.
The Processing Scientist is expected to lead all scale up efforts during the development stage including, Plant Trials, Production Start-Up, and any trouble shooting associated with production. This role will lead commercialization of initiatives across NPD, Maintenance of Core items, and CCI. The Processing Scientist will partner with product developers, operations internally and externally, to ensure optimal translation from bench to production and lead process
improvements. The product and process design are critical for large scale production of high-quality products.
RESPONSIBILITIES Lead processing development in support of all NPD and Core Maintenance (including CCI) efforts R&D lead at plant trials and production start-ups. Make recommendations to Product Developers for changes to formulations based on plant trials and production runs. Problem solve/trouble shoot to ensure processing is optimal. Educate/train Product Developers and Manufacturing partners as needed. Ensure design of products and processes are optimized early in development. Manage and conduct plant ‘scale ups’ and monitor first production runs with a strong understanding of the product commercialization steps and key product attributes.
Follow robust trial procedures and manage the process prior to and during the trial. Ensure that comprehensive trial reports are published after each trial documenting each step of the process from start to finish. Improve process to capture cost savings and efficiencies. Through improved processes resulting in reduced waste, down time, and non-conforming materials etc. take unnecessary cost out of the business. Improve specifications and standard operating instructions to ensure better conformity of manufacture, smoother, faster start ups Challenge unnecessary processes or procedures particularly where they lead to cost.
